Full description
If you do not understand anything on this page please contact us.
Surface find. Flint piece is patinated a cream colour with some staining. A small amount of modern retouch has occurred to tranchet sharpened end but is in otherwise good condition showing only light abrasion to arrises.(1)
Mesolithic Thames pick found during fieldwalking in 2000. 105mm x 44mm. (2)
